HTTP安全策略:实施强密码策略
HTTP安全策略:实施强密码策略
在当今数字化时代,网络安全是一个非常重要的话题。随着互联网的普及和应用程序的增加,保护用户数据和隐私的需求变得越来越迫切。HTTP安全策略是确保网络通信安全的关键组成部分之一。其中,实施强密码策略是保护用户账户免受恶意攻击的重要措施。
什么是HTTP安全策略?
HTTP(超文本传输协议)是一种用于在Web浏览器和Web服务器之间传输数据的协议。HTTP安全策略是指通过各种技术和措施来保护HTTP通信的安全性,以防止数据泄露、篡改和其他恶意攻击。
为什么实施强密码策略很重要?
密码是用户账户的第一道防线。弱密码容易被猜测或破解,从而导致账户被盗用或信息泄露。实施强密码策略可以有效提高账户的安全性,保护用户的个人信息和资产。
如何实施强密码策略?
以下是一些实施强密码策略的最佳实践:
- 密码长度要求:设置密码最小长度要求,通常建议至少8个字符。
- 密码复杂性要求:要求密码包含大小写字母、数字和特殊字符,以增加密码的复杂性。
- 密码定期更换:要求用户定期更换密码,通常建议每3个月更换一次。
- 禁止常见密码:禁止用户使用常见密码,如"123456"、"password"等。
- 多因素身份验证:推荐使用多因素身份验证,例如结合密码和手机验证码。
示例代码:密码强度检查
以下是一个简单的JavaScript代码示例,用于检查密码的强度:
function checkPasswordStrength(password) {
var strength = 0;
if (password.length >= 8) {
strength++;
}
if (/[a-z]/.test(password) && /[A-Z]/.test(password)) {
strength++;
}
if (/d/.test(password)) {
strength++;
}
if (/[!@#$%^&*]/.test(password)) {
strength++;
}
return strength;
}
通过调用checkPasswordStrength
函数并传入密码作为参数,可以得到密码的强度值。根据返回的强度值,可以采取相应的措施,例如要求用户输入更强的密码。
总结
实施强密码策略是保护用户账户安全的重要步骤。通过设置密码长度要求、密码复杂性要求、定期更换密码、禁止常见密码以及使用多因素身份验证等措施,可以有效提高账户的安全性。在保护用户数据和隐私方面,后浪云是您的可靠合作伙伴。
相关链接:
版权声明:
作者:后浪云
链接:https://www.idc.net/help/238213/
文章版权归作者所有,未经允许请勿转载。
THE END